The Secret Operation Project Mockingbird was a covert project started by the Central Intelligence Agency in the mid-20th century. Its goal was to manipulate the news and shape public opinion.

The Agency hired journalists and penetrated major press bodies to spread propaganda that supported their missions. This project involved planting fabricated articles and quieting dissenting voices.

The methods employed in Project Mockingbird were wide-reaching and complex. From financing news organizations to embedding operatives within editorial boards, the Agency ensured their propaganda reached the public.
